Output 81c9402fb638dc9d0226223bf5a213cba8f3a3e0a6d209a9fcda3164c9e23aed:1

value
628053
script pubkey
OP_0 OP_PUSHBYTES_20 531d520f36c6b03b8b3c0b632e56d151154142fa
address
bc1q2vw4yrekc6crhzeupd3ju4k32y25zsh62wlrw4
transaction
81c9402fb638dc9d0226223bf5a213cba8f3a3e0a6d209a9fcda3164c9e23aed
spent
true